Abstract

In recent years, introduction of self-healing coatings based on microcapsules containing healing agent
and green corrosion inhibitor opened a new chapter in the manufacture of organic polymer coatings. In
this regard microcapsules based on poly (melamine-formaldehyde) get noticed. In this work, melamineformaldehyde
microcapsules containing air-dried alkyd resin with cerium nitrate as a corrosion inhibitor
are synthesized by in situ polymerization. Then synthesized microcapsules were used into epoxy
resin. Anti-corrosion properties and self-repairing of coating were investigated. Scanning electron microscope,
differential scanning calorimetry, Fourier transform infrared spectroscopy (FT-IR) and electrochemical
impedance spectroscopy were used to survey. Finally, by selecting a microcapsule, which
was synthesized by agitation rate of 800 rpm, and using polyvinyl pyrrolidone as a colloidal stabilizer,
in 7.5% by weight with epoxy coating was applied. The results show a better corrosion resistance from
1.44×103 (Ω/cm2) to 2.83×108 (Ω/cm2) and self-repairing coating.
